Albania's Energy Crossroads: Hydropower Dependence & Solar Opportunity

A Balkan nation with 300+ sunny days annually, yet importing 40% of its electricity. Albania's paradox stems from over-reliance on hydropower (95% of domestic production), leaving it vulnerable to droughts like the 2022 crisis that spiked energy imports by 67%. Solar Radiation Data: Albania's Hidden Goldmine

Albania's solar potential outshines much of Europe. With average irradiation levels of 1,500–1,700 kWh/m²/year, coastal regions rival solar champions like Spain. Compare this to Germany (1,000 kWh/m²) where solar thrives – Albania's untapped capacity is staggering. According to Global Solar Atlas, just 1% of Albania's land could generate 5.2 TWh annually – enough to eliminate energy imports. That's equivalent to:

  • Powering 1.2 million homes
  • Reducing CO₂ by 1.8 million tons/year
  • Saving €290 million in annual import costs

Case Study: Karavasta Solar Farm – Blueprint for Success

Proof emerges near Fier, where the 140 MW Karavasta Solar Farm – Albania's largest PV project – demonstrates solar's viability. Developed by French renewable giant Voltalia, this €160 million project showcases:

  • Output: 265 GWh/year (enough for 70,000 households)
  • Land Efficiency: 196 hectares for maximum yield
  • Economic Impact: Created 800+ local jobs during construction

As noted in their construction report, the project leverages Albania's 15-year PPA guarantee, proving bankability in emerging markets. "This isn't just about megawatts," says project manager Elena Gjika. "It's about showing how solar stabilizes Albania's grid while creating local value."

Breaking Down Solar Costs: ROI in Albania's Market

Wondering about practical economics? Let's analyze a 10 kW residential installation in Tirana:

  • Installation Cost: €11,000–€14,000 (30% lower than EU average)
  • Government Incentives: VAT exemption + net metering
  • Payback Period: 6–8 years (vs. 10+ in Germany)
  • Lifetime Savings: €25,000+ (based on current tariffs)

Commercial projects benefit further. The Albanian Energy Regulatory Authority's renewable tariff structure guarantees €85/MWh for solar – a 20% premium over regional averages. Combine this with plummeting panel costs (down 89% since 2010), and Albania's solar math becomes irresistible.

Storage Synergy: Why Solar + Batteries Changes Everything

Here's where it gets exciting. Solar's intermittency concern vanishes when paired with storage – a critical advantage in Albania's mountainous terrain. Recent projects like the Kopshtira solar-battery hybrid demonstrate:

  • 92% self-consumption rate (vs. 40% without storage)
  • 4-hour backup during grid outages
  • ROI boost of 18–22% through peak shaving

Lithium-ion costs have dropped 97% since 1991, making storage integration economically logical. As IRENA's 2023 report confirms, solar-storage hybrids now outcompete diesel gensets across the Balkans – a game-changer for Albania's remote communities.
